Energy Minister Bogdan Ivan has unveiled a new €150 million energy storage program, expected to deliver 385 MW of battery storage projects across Romanian municipalities. Romania has taken another. . Privately held MASS Group Holding plans to invest more than €1 billion (~$1. 18 billion) in large-scale battery energy storage projects in Romania after reaching an agreement with the Romanian government, Reuters reported on Wednesday.
